Reports Reveals Vast Discrepancies in Voter Records

The Takeaway

A new report by the Pew Center on the States reveals that one of every eight active registrations is either invalid or inaccurate.  Along with voters with registrations in multiple states, their findings revealed that approximately 1.8 million dead people are still listed as active voters. Equally troubling is the discovery that one in four people who are eligible to vote –  some 51 million people –  are not registered.   Adam Liptak is the Supreme Court correspondent for our partner The New York Times.
